			Synchrotron SAXS 
		
        data from solutions of
        Mixture of estrogen-related receptor gamma:Inverse repeat IR3 DNA - 6:3 and 2:1 complexes - at 1.9 mg/ml
		
		    in 
			20 mM Tris-HCl, 100 mM NaCl, 100 mM KCl, 5 mM MgCl2, 1% (v/v) glycerol, and 1 mM CHAPS, pH 8
		
 		were collected
		
		on the
		
			EMBL X33 beam line  
		
		
			at the DORIS III, DESY storage ring
		
		
			(Hamburg, Germany)
		
		
		
			using a Pilatus 2M detector
		
		
			at a sample-detector distance of 2.7 m and
		
		
			at a wavelength of λ = 0.15 nm
		
		(I(s) vs s, where s = 4πsinθ/λ, and 2θ is the scattering angle).
                
			One solute concentration of 1.90 mg/ml was measured
                        at 10°C.
		
			Eight successive
			
				15 second frames were collected.
			
		
			The data were normalized to the intensity of the transmitted beam and radially averaged; the scattering of the solvent-blank was subtracted.
